dc.description Electromagnetic shielding of metallic enclosures with an aperture is simulated by means of COMSOL in this paper. The effect of the polarization type, the thickness of material and material type on electrical shielding effectiveness has been investigated to give suggestions to enclosure designers to get better performance against to EMI. It is obtained that locating rectangular aperture in vertical position with respect to the direction of source results in better electrical shielding performance. Performance of an enclosure whose thickness is about a skin depth is 6dB worse than the enclosure whose thickness is in the order of five times skin depth. As expected, higher conducting materials need to be preferred rather than poor one. Silver, aluminum, cupper and chrome are in the order of better to worst.
